RINGWOOD School has been awarded a Kew Gardens Grow Wild grant for a wildflower site in the town.
The seeds were scattered on each side of Southampton Road during April. The £10.5m Grow Wild project aims to bring communities together to sow, grow and support UK native wild flowers.
